Auditors

Duration of the Head Auditor’s mandate and term of office

The auditor has been PricewaterhouseCoopers Ltd (Zurich) since financial year 2020. The duration of each mandate assigned to PricewaterhouseCoopers Ltd is one financial year (Art. 24 of the Articles of Association). The current mandate commenced on 1 June 2020. The position of Head Auditor is held by Michael Abresch. According to Art. 730a of the Swiss Code of Obligations, the head auditor’s mandate shall not generally exceed seven years.

 

Auditing fees

In the reporting year, the fee invoiced by the auditor amounted to a total of CHF 440’000. This includes audit work related to the opening balance sheet, capital increases, listing and the current financial statements.

 

Additional fees

There were no additional fees in the reporting year.

 

Informational instruments of the External Audit

In particular, the AC is tasked with effective and regular monitoring of the auditor's reports in order to ensure their quality, integrity, independency, and transparency. The auditor's representatives participated in all three AC meetings during the financial year. The audit plan, including the fees, is presented to the members of the AC and discussed with them. In the meetings, the auditor reports the main findings to the AC together with the related recommendations.
